Kevin Hinkle
Kevin Hinkle is a professor of English to Speakers of Other Languages. He is also a poet and visual artist who has published work in Impossible Archetype (Ireland), SurVision (Ireland), Naugatuck River Review, Baltimore Review, Tupelo Quarterly, Grey Sparrow, Tulane Review, The Tishman Review, and Utter. He lives in New Jersey with his husband, writer Michael McKeown Bondhus. This is his first chapbook.
